Cragnotti forced to sell Nesta

Lazio President Sergio Cragnotti claims that he was forced to sell Alessandro Nesta to Milan this summer.

The capital chief’s decision to sacrifice the player has come under the spotlight after Lazio’s defensive display in the 3-2 defeat to Chievo on Sunday.

But Cragnotti maintains he had no option but to release the international at a cut-price £20m.

"The truth behind the sale is that the big clubs (Milan, Inter and Juventus) made a pact that they wouldn’t spend too much for the defender," said Cragnotti.
